Pros

great place to learn and gain experience.

Cons

Definitely not a great place to stay more than a couple years as all they are efficient at is roll out work. So be prepared to work on the same job for at least one year minimum. With that said, there isn't a lot of creative freedom. WD is in reality a revolving door for freelancers, interns, and young college graduates that are willing to work a ton of hours each week.

Pros

WD Partners is an all-inclusive retail design firm that provides creative services in: marketing/insights, interior environments, architecture, engineering, operations, digital/3D, and implementation. Given the diversity of services, employees have access to tapping into these specialties/ resources internally. WD offers its employees multiple avenues & opportunities to take on more projects if desired. The team structure is designed to build each designers' creative skills while maintaining the core brand identity.

Cons

If brought on to WD under a 90 day contract position, the contract usually extends out to a year rather than 3 months. Given the nature of the design industry as a whole, business tends to fluxuate quite often. Meaning job security is not promised if there are no projects/ new business developing. Look at yr. 2009 for example. However WD was one of the only design firms in the region to stay afloat during this economic downturn because of a few revolving big box/cpg store accounts.
